Kevin Kölsch's and Dennis Widmyer's taunt direction and clever cinematics really bowled me over when I saw the L.A. premiere in September.The film haunted me for an entire week afterwards due to the relentless tension built in it through exquisite lighting, editing, music scoring, and the pair's direction.
However the most impressive ingredient in STARRY EYES is the stunning break-out performance by Alexandra Essoe in the lead role! This up & coming actress enriches her character with mind-boggling integrity, honesty, and vulnerability throughout the entire film.
The transformation that Essoe completes with her character from beginning to end is an absolute marvel to see. This is one of the most physically demanding and visceral portrayals I've ever seen on the big screen, and I was in awe of Essoe's willingness and courage to lay it all out there like she does.
STARRY EYES could very well prove to be a huge career kick starter for Alexandra Essoe.
